How the Departmentβs Safety Approach Functions in Practice
How the Wilmington Police Department Keeps NC's Coastline Safe and Secure begins with a structured blend of patrol strategies and public engagement. Officers conduct regular foot and vehicle patrols along the shoreline and commercial corridors, building a visible presence. Specialized units may handle marine operations, ensuring waterways are monitored responsibly. Technology, such as camera systems and communication tools, supports coordination between teams and other emergency services. This integrated model aims to deter incidents and enable rapid response when necessary.
Community involvement is a cornerstone of the strategy. Neighborhood watch programs, business alliances, and visitor education campaigns all play a role. For instance, officers might meet with hotel staff to discuss noise management and safety protocols during peak events. Partnerships with local organizations help share information about water conditions and crowd management. The emphasis is on collaboration, which reinforces trust and shared responsibility for public safety.
Training and adaptation ensure these efforts remain effective. Officers receive instruction in cultural awareness, crisis de-escalation, and environmental awareness specific to coastal settings. Scenario-based drills prepare teams for situations like crowded beach rescues or event security. Data from incident reports helps leaders adjust deployment and allocate resources thoughtfully. Through this continuous refinement, the department seeks a balance between hospitality and protection.
Common Questions About Coastal Safety Measures
What hours are patrols most active along the coastline?
Patrol schedules are designed to align with high-traffic periods, such as daytime hours and evening events. Officers increase presence during dawn, dusk, and nighttime when visibility changes and activity patterns shift. Adjustments are made for holidays, festivals, and weather events. This flexibility helps maintain consistent coverage without overwhelming residents or visitors.

How are emergency situations handled in crowded beach areas?
In busy settings, the department relies on clear communication plans and designated staging areas. First responders coordinate with lifeguards, fire services, and medical teams to manage incidents efficiently. Crowd control measures may include temporary barriers or redirected foot traffic. The focus remains on stabilizing the scene and providing assistance while minimizing disruption to other beachgoers.
Can tourists report concerns in real time?
Yes, multiple reporting channels are available, including non-emergency lines and mobile apps when implemented. Visitors are encouraged to share details about suspicious activity or safety hazards promptly. Language support and clear instructions help ensure that reports are accurate and actionable. Timely information allows the department to address potential issues before they escalate.
